Monitorar o appliance do GitHub Enterprise Server
O aumento do uso da sua instância do GitHub Enterprise Server ao longo do tempo acarreta também o aumento do uso dos recursos do sistema, como CPU, memória e armazenamento. Você pode configurar o monitoramento e os alertas para identificar os possíveis problemas antes que eles impactem negativamente o desempenho ou a disponibilidade do aplicativo.
Acessar o painel de monitoramento
O GitHub Enterprise Server inclui um painel de monitoramento baseado na web que exibe os dados de histórico do seu appliance do GitHub Enterprise Server, como uso de CPU e armazenamento, tempos de resposta de aplicativos e autenticação, e informações gerais sobre a integridade do sistema.
Limites de alerta recomendados
É possível configurar um alerta para receber notificações sobre os problemas de recursos do sistema antes que eles afetem o desempenho do appliance do GitHub Enterprise Server.
Configurar monitoramento externo
É possível monitorar os recursos básicos do sistema no appliance do GitHub Enterprise Server usando os protocolos de coleta de estatísticas SNMP ou collectd.
Configurar collectd
O GitHub Enterprise pode coletar dados com collectd
e enviá-los para um servidor externo collectd
. Reunimos um conjunto padrão de dados e outras métricas, como uso de CPU, consumo de memória e disco, tráfego e erros da interface de rede e carga geral da VM.
Encaminhamento de logs
O GitHub Enterprise usa syslog-ng
para encaminhar logs do sistema e de aplicativos para o servidor especificado nas configurações do Console de gerenciamento.
Monitorar usando SNMP
O GitHub Enterprise fornece dados sobre o uso de disco, CPU, memória e muito mais no SNMP.